Idk bout n64, but on retroarch psx is very far from being near perfect :P.
It still is missing dynarec & literally everything needs overclock, some harder to emulate even with overclock will still fail.
N64 gets by on a number of tweaks, and those hard to emulate games definately require OC.
Also if all you care about is emulation, Android 10 is pretty much the pinacle for 90%.
Ubuntu is better for 1 or 2, and Horizon has Citra for 3ds emu which outperforms the others.
